Port Everglades Welcomes Carnival Sunrise

Port Everglades welcomed Carnival Cruise Line’s Carnival Sunrise on her first call to the port at a ceremony held onboard today, presenting the ship with a commemorative plaque. 

The Carnival Sunrise, which will be homeported at Port Everglades for the winter season, will offer four- and five-day itineraries to the Bahamas, as well as the Eastern and Western Caribbean.
